Employability and Careers…
If you are an ENU student and starting to think about life after university and considering what career paths are most desirable and open to you, our Employability and Careers team are here to help! They can support you with a variety of different aspects of career planning and job finding such as building your CV, writing an effective cover letter, organising work experience and placement opportunities, and putting together job applications. Our Employability and Careers service can also help you find a part-time job that fits in with your studies and offers a range of different resources to help support you with this. They also offer resilient skills training and workshops which can aid with your personal development and career progression by helping to enhance your professional effectiveness, productivity and personal resilience. Looking to start your own business? The Bright Red Triangle is a community and hub of innovation within Napier which can help young entrepreneurs to build and develop on their business idea, social enterprise or charity. These services are entirely free for ENU students, staff and alumni and offer individually tailored advice regarding business and entrepreneurial matters.
You can find out more about how to contact our Employability and Careers Team or book a one-on-one appointment with them through our Careers Support My Napier webpages. Please note that our careers services and support is still available to ENU alumni for up to two years after graduating.
International Support…
Our Visa and International Support team can help all our international student community with queries regarding a range of different matters such as immigration, visas and visa applications. Regarding visas specifically, they can also give specialist advice on matters concerning applications both within and outwith the UK, visas for employment in the UK during and after your studies, letters for immigration purposes, visas for graduation attendance and attendance tracking of student visa holders. The Visa and International Support Team also frequently work in collaboration with our Admissions Team to ensure that all immigration and travel advice is up-to-date and consistent for new and returning students at Edinburgh Napier University.
You can find out more about our Visa and International Support Team and general support for new, returning and graduating international students on our International Students My Napier information webpages. Accommodation…
The three main student accommodation buildings for Edinburgh Napier University students are Bainfield, Orwell Terrace and Slateford Road. Altogether, they provide a place to live for over 1,200 students across the city of Edinburgh with modern facilities which are maintained and supported by our Accommodation team at Edinburgh Napier University. Although there is a wide variety of information available on our My Napier Accommodation webpages that can cover a majority of general accommodation queries such as applications, rent payments, flat viewings and moving in (or out), our accommodation officers and support team can also help with any questions you may have and can be contacted via email or telephone. We also have a Accommodation FAQs page with advice covering flat contents, what to bring, Wi-Fi, laundry and washing facilities, reception hours and travel.

IT Support and Service Desk…
Have you tried turning your device on and off again? Sometimes, this may be the solution, but that may not aways be the case and could be an issue with a university-managed device or software that requires investigation. This is where our IT teams come in – IT support from our IS Service Desk is available 24 hours in the day, seven days a week. Online resources can also be provided to help you get the best use out of our IT systems and equipment. Our Service Desk and IT team can also assist with you issues regarding Wi-Fi connection, setting up your MFA (Multi-Factor Authenticator) and getting logged into the Edinburgh Napier App. You can also visit our campus library helpdesks at any of our three campus libraries or JKCC helpdesk at Merchiston if you would like to speak to our IT team in person regarding technical issues you are having with a university managed device, network, laptop or software.
You can contact our IS Service Desk team by emailing ISServiceDesk@napier.ac.uk or alternatively contact them by phoning 0131 455 3000. Outwith the hours of 8:45am-4:45pm Monday to Friday, IT support is provided through our NORMAN helpline where you will receive a reply from the email address e59.servicedesk@normanmanagedservices.ac.uk.
Finance…
Our finance team can provide guidance and support with a range of queries regarding tuition fee payments, student loan applications and how to access a wide range of funding to assist with circumstances and matters such as living costs or childcare expenses. They can also provide help and advice if you are worried you may not be able to pay your tuition or accommodation fees and even help you to set a budget to manage all outgoings and expenses you may have.
You can find contact details for our Finance Team in our Who to contact webpage in the finance section of our My Napier webpages.
